Orban pressures Ukraine over oil blockade - Break The Fake - TVP WORLD [View all]



The Hungarian government announced that it intends to push for the Druzhba oil pipeline in Ukraine to resume operation "by any means necessary," even though Russian oil transit remains suspended. In a new episode of Break The Fake, Benjamin Lee takes a closer look at how the pipeline actually stopped operating and why the political narrative surrounding the dispute is becoming increasingly controversial.
